On August 16, 1996 — Trailing, 2 – 0, the Orioles score 14 runs over the final three innings to defeat the Athletics, 14 – 3, in the first game of a doubleheader. Rafael Palmeiro drives home six runs for Baltimore, and each member of the starting lineup, with the exception of leadoff man Roberto Alomar, gets at least two hits. The Orioles stroke 19 hits for the second day in a row off Oakland pitching. Baltimore also takes the nightcap, 5 – 4 in 10 innings.
